The findings of the research are presented as follows:1. The verbal feedback of excellent English teachers serves scaffolding function in developing students’language ability. The highquality verbal feedback provides prehensible language input, and meanwhile elicits more and better language output from the learners, whose interlanguage can thus be improved in the course of errorcorrecting through teacher’s . The verbal feedback of excellent English teachers serves scaffolding function in the development of students’cognitive petence. The highquality verbal feedback guides students to learn to think, to find problems, to make analysis and seek solutions to the problems, all of which contribute to the development of their cognitive .
